DIGEST

Protest that the solicitation contained a latent ambiguity or that the solicitation did not
reflect the agency's needs is denied, where the contemporaneous record does not
reflect that the agency's interpretation of the solicitation prior to the protest differed from
the protester's interpretation, and there is no evidence the protester was prejudiced.
DECISION

DocMagic Inc., of Torrance, California, protests the award of a contract to LogicEase
Solutions, Inc. (LogicEase), of Burlingame, California, by the Consumer Financial
Protection Bureau (CFPB) under request for proposals (RFP) No. CFP-1 7-R-0001 7,
which was issued for mortgage loan compliance analysis software licenses. The
protester alleges that the solicitation did not reflect the agency's actual needs or, in the
alternative, contained a latent ambiguity regarding the scope of services sought.


We deny the protest.
